Keith W. Fitzpatrick, 63, of Blackstone and formerly a longtime resident of Upton, passed away peacefully on Thursday, December 18, 2025, at Milford Regional Medical Center, surrounded by his loving family.
Born in Norwood, Keith was the son of the late Raymond and Patricia (Ohm) Fitzpatrick. He was raised and educated in Upton and was a graduate of Nipmuc Regional High School.
Keith proudly served his country in the United States Navy, attaining the rank of EMFA.
He was self-employed as a carpenter for many years and took great pride in his work, frequently lending his skills to friends and others in the construction field.
Keith also served the Town of Upton as Dog Officer for 20 years, faithfully fulfilling a role previously held by his parents, Raymond and Patricia.
Keith had a deep love for the outdoors and enjoyed fishing, hiking, billiards, and adventures with his grandchildren. He remained active and social, continuing to enjoy outings and time with loved ones even during illness. Above all, he cherished spending time with family and friends.
He is survived by his former wife, Suzanne Fitzpatrick; his stepchildren, Nicole Moberg and William Moberg and his wife Ashley; his cherished step-grandchildren, Skylar, Logan, Maura, and Elliot; his sisters, Adrienne St. Cyr and her husband John, and Susan White; his nephew, Evan St. Cyr; and many beloved cousins.
